How can we as Christians persevere in difficult times?

Answered in 1 source

We persevere by fixing our eyes on Jesus and remembering the joy of our future salvation.

Perseverance in difficult times requires a steadfast focus on Jesus Christ, who is our ultimate example of faithfulness and endurance. Hebrews 12:2 instructs believers to look to Jesus, who endured significant suffering for the joy set before Him — the joy of saving His people. This perspective shifts our focus from current struggles to the eternal glory we will experience with Him. As Philippians 1:6 encourages, we can trust in God's faithfulness to carry us through our trials, knowing that He who began a good work in us will be faithful to complete it. This assurance fuels our perseverance as we call upon Him in prayer and remember His promises.
Scripture References: Hebrews 12:2, Philippians 1:6, Romans 5:3-5
